• There is NO official Otland's Discord server and NO official Otland's server list. The Otland's Staff does not manage any Discord server or server list. Moderators or administrator of any Discord server or server lists have NO connection to the Otland's Staff. Do not get scammed!

lua script error "parsemessage" gusb

gappe

New Member
Joined
Jul 17, 2009
Messages
71
Reaction score
0
I got a wrong error newly how do i fix this? rep+++
Code:
[17/12/2009 17:11:34] Lua Script Error: [Npc interface] 
[17/12/2009 17:11:34] data/npc/scripts/TP/boat_libertybay.lua:onCreatureSay

[17/12/2009 17:11:34] data/npc/lib/npcsystem/npchandler.lua:301: bad argument #1 to 'gsub' (string expected, got nil)
[17/12/2009 17:11:34] stack traceback:
[17/12/2009 17:11:34] 	[C]: in function 'gsub'
[17/12/2009 17:11:34] 	data/npc/lib/npcsystem/npchandler.lua:301: in function 'parseMessage'
[17/12/2009 17:11:34] 	data/npc/lib/npcsystem/modules.lua:55: in function 'callback'
[17/12/2009 17:11:34] 	data/npc/lib/npcsystem/keywordhandler.lua:40: in function 'processMessage'
[17/12/2009 17:11:34] 	data/npc/lib/npcsystem/keywordhandler.lua:168: in function 'processNodeMessage'
[17/12/2009 17:11:34] 	data/npc/lib/npcsystem/keywordhandler.lua:122: in function 'processMessage'
[17/12/2009 17:11:34] 	data/npc/lib/npcsystem/npchandler.lua:380: in function 'onCreatureSay'
[17/12/2009 17:11:34] 	data/npc/scripts/TP/boat_libertybay.lua:10: in function <data/npc/scripts/TP/boat_libertybay.lua:10>

[17/12/2009 17:11:38] Lua Script Error: [Npc interface] 
[17/12/2009 17:11:38] data/npc/scripts/TP/boat_libertybay.lua:onCreatureSay

[17/12/2009 17:11:38] data/npc/lib/npcsystem/npchandler.lua:301: bad argument #1 to 'gsub' (string expected, got nil)
[17/12/2009 17:11:38] stack traceback:
[17/12/2009 17:11:38] 	[C]: in function 'gsub'
[17/12/2009 17:11:38] 	data/npc/lib/npcsystem/npchandler.lua:301: in function 'parseMessage'
[17/12/2009 17:11:38] 	data/npc/lib/npcsystem/modules.lua:55: in function 'callback'
[17/12/2009 17:11:38] 	data/npc/lib/npcsystem/keywordhandler.lua:40: in function 'processMessage'
[17/12/2009 17:11:38] 	data/npc/lib/npcsystem/keywordhandler.lua:168: in function 'processNodeMessage'
[17/12/2009 17:11:38] 	data/npc/lib/npcsystem/keywordhandler.lua:128: in function 'processMessage'
[17/12/2009 17:11:38] 	data/npc/lib/npcsystem/npchandler.lua:380: in function 'onCreatureSay'
[17/12/2009 17:11:38] 	data/npc/scripts/TP/boat_libertybay.lua:10: in function <data/npc/scripts/TP/boat_libertybay.lua:10>

[17/12/2009 17:11:52] Lua Script Error: [Npc interface] 
[17/12/2009 17:11:52] data/npc/scripts/TP/boat_libertybay.lua:onCreatureSay

[17/12/2009 17:11:52] data/npc/lib/npcsystem/npchandler.lua:301: bad argument #1 to 'gsub' (string expected, got nil)
[17/12/2009 17:11:52] stack traceback:
[17/12/2009 17:11:52] 	[C]: in function 'gsub'
[17/12/2009 17:11:52] 	data/npc/lib/npcsystem/npchandler.lua:301: in function 'parseMessage'
[17/12/2009 17:11:52] 	data/npc/lib/npcsystem/modules.lua:55: in function 'callback'
[17/12/2009 17:11:52] 	data/npc/lib/npcsystem/keywordhandler.lua:40: in function 'processMessage'
[17/12/2009 17:11:52] 	data/npc/lib/npcsystem/keywordhandler.lua:168: in function 'processNodeMessage'
[17/12/2009 17:11:52] 	data/npc/lib/npcsystem/keywordhandler.lua:122: in function 'processMessage'
[17/12/2009 17:11:52] 	data/npc/lib/npcsystem/npchandler.lua:380: in function 'onCreatureSay'
[17/12/2009 17:11:52] 	data/npc/scripts/TP/boat_libertybay.lua:10: in function <data/npc/scripts/TP/boat_libertybay.lua:10>
[17/12/2009 17:11:53] Spy has logged in.

[17/12/2009 17:11:57] Lua Script Error: [Npc interface] 
[17/12/2009 17:11:57] data/npc/scripts/TP/boat_libertybay.lua:onCreatureSay

[17/12/2009 17:11:57] data/npc/lib/npcsystem/npchandler.lua:301: bad argument #1 to 'gsub' (string expected, got nil)
[17/12/2009 17:11:57] stack traceback:
[17/12/2009 17:11:57] 	[C]: in function 'gsub'
[17/12/2009 17:11:57] 	data/npc/lib/npcsystem/npchandler.lua:301: in function 'parseMessage'
[17/12/2009 17:11:57] 	data/npc/lib/npcsystem/modules.lua:55: in function 'callback'
[17/12/2009 17:11:57] 	data/npc/lib/npcsystem/keywordhandler.lua:40: in function 'processMessage'
[17/12/2009 17:11:57] 	data/npc/lib/npcsystem/keywordhandler.lua:168: in function 'processNodeMessage'
[17/12/2009 17:11:57] 	data/npc/lib/npcsystem/keywordhandler.lua:128: in function 'processMessage'
[17/12/2009 17:11:57] 	data/npc/lib/npcsystem/npchandler.lua:380: in function 'onCreatureSay'
[17/12/2009 17:11:57] 	data/npc/scripts/TP/boat_libertybay.lua:10: in function <data/npc/scripts/TP/boat_libertybay.lua:10>

[17/12/2009 17:11:59] Lua Script Error: [Npc interface] 
[17/12/2009 17:11:59] data/npc/scripts/TP/boat_libertybay.lua:onCreatureSay

[17/12/2009 17:11:59] data/npc/lib/npcsystem/npchandler.lua:301: bad argument #1 to 'gsub' (string expected, got nil)
[17/12/2009 17:11:59] stack traceback:
[17/12/2009 17:11:59] 	[C]: in function 'gsub'
[17/12/2009 17:11:59] 	data/npc/lib/npcsystem/npchandler.lua:301: in function 'parseMessage'
[17/12/2009 17:11:59] 	data/npc/lib/npcsystem/modules.lua:55: in function 'callback'
[17/12/2009 17:11:59] 	data/npc/lib/npcsystem/keywordhandler.lua:40: in function 'processMessage'
[17/12/2009 17:11:59] 	data/npc/lib/npcsystem/keywordhandler.lua:168: in function 'processNodeMessage'
[17/12/2009 17:11:59] 	data/npc/lib/npcsystem/keywordhandler.lua:122: in function 'processMessage'
[17/12/2009 17:11:59] 	data/npc/lib/npcsystem/npchandler.lua:380: in function 'onCreatureSay'
[17/12/2009 17:11:59] 	data/npc/scripts/TP/boat_libertybay.lua:10: in function <data/npc/scripts/TP/boat_libertybay.lua:10>
[17/12/2009 17:12:06] Max Poy has logged out.

[17/12/2009 17:12:11] Lua Script Error: [Npc interface] 
[17/12/2009 17:12:11] data/npc/scripts/TP/boat_libertybay.lua:onCreatureSay

[17/12/2009 17:12:11] data/npc/lib/npcsystem/npchandler.lua:301: bad argument #1 to 'gsub' (string expected, got nil)
[17/12/2009 17:12:11] stack traceback:
[17/12/2009 17:12:11] 	[C]: in function 'gsub'
[17/12/2009 17:12:11] 	data/npc/lib/npcsystem/npchandler.lua:301: in function 'parseMessage'
[17/12/2009 17:12:11] 	data/npc/lib/npcsystem/modules.lua:55: in function 'callback'
[17/12/2009 17:12:11] 	data/npc/lib/npcsystem/keywordhandler.lua:40: in function 'processMessage'
[17/12/2009 17:12:11] 	data/npc/lib/npcsystem/keywordhandler.lua:168: in function 'processNodeMessage'
[17/12/2009 17:12:11] 	data/npc/lib/npcsystem/keywordhandler.lua:122: in function 'processMessage'
[17/12/2009 17:12:11] 	data/npc/lib/npcsystem/npchandler.lua:380: in function 'onCreatureSay'
[17/12/2009 17:12:11] 	data/npc/scripts/TP/boat_libertybay.lua:10: in function <data/npc/scripts/TP/boat_libertybay.lua:10>

Also got something about a vocation?

Code:
[17/12/2009 17:16:22] [Warning - Vocations::getVocation] Vocation 4294967295 not found.
[17/12/2009 17:16:22] [Warning - Vocations::getVocation] Vocation 4294967295 not found.
[17/12/2009 17:16:22] [Warning - Vocations::getVocation] Vocation 4294967295 not found.

:S Rep++ for help
 
Simple as hell, post your data/npc/scripts/TP/boat_libertybay.lua
I am the cause of that error so I know how to fix it.
 
I have exactly the same problem with this script:

local keywordHandler = KeywordHandler:new()
local npcHandler = NpcHandler:new(keywordHandler)
NpcSystem.parseParameters(npcHandler)

-- OTServ event handling functions start
function onCreatureAppear(cid) npcHandler: onCreatureAppear(cid) end
function onCreatureDisappear(cid) npcHandler: onCreatureDisappear(cid) end
function onCreatureSay(cid, type, msg) npcHandler: onCreatureSay(cid, type, msg) end
function onThink() npcHandler: onThink() end
-- OTServ event handling functions end

npcHandler:addModule(FocusModule:new())
 
Back
Top